Special meeting of the Board of Commissioners, July
6th, 1925, for the purpose of hearing any complaints that
may be rade by property owners as to the appraisement placed
upon their property on which to base the cost of:
Curbing and guttering Cedar Street from Phillips
Street to College Avenue;
excavating and paving between Santa Fe Avenue
_alley
and Seventh Street from '.'lalnut S_treet south 225 fe;t;
Ltcavating and paving Second Street from ,"alnut treet
to I,ulberry Street;
He -curb? n - and guttering Santa Fe avenue from '.'.'alnut
Street to I,Tulberry Street.
I,hyor "Largett, presiding, and Corissioners Iia
mlrgett.
Cha-lbers and Campbell and C•; ty Attorney ITTorris being present.
